ANOTHER BRITISH RECORD HOLDER.
HUNDRED METRES SWIMMING TITLE ANNEXED.
London, Feb. 9. Misa Joyca Cooper, of Kingston-on- Thames, broke the 100 metres Euro- pean swimming recard for women, in on International contest held by the Paris Swimmers' Club yesterday.
Her time, was 70 seconds, The previous record was held by Mademoiselle Braun, of Holland, and was 71 4/6 seconds.-British Wirclees,
